Abstract

A controlling node for a cellular communications system, arranged to determine and transmit commands for Transmit Power Control, TPC, to one or more Mobile Terminals, MTs, in at least one cell in the system. The controlling node is arranged to classify an MT as being in one of a number of states, and to use differing methods for determining an MT's TPC command depending on which state the MT is in, so that one method is used for determining TPC commands to an MT in the active state and another method is used for determining TPC commands to an MT in the passive state.
